The Science Behind Chill Out: Understanding Freon and Your AC

Freon, also known as refrigerant, is a critical component of air conditioning systems. It's responsible for transferring heat from inside the AC to outside, keeping your home or office cool and comfortable. However, not all Freons are created equal. The type and quality of Freon used in your AC can significantly impact its efficiency, lifespan, and environmental impact.

Understanding Freon Types: The Good, the Bad, and the Green

There are several types of Freon available, each with its unique characteristics and environmental impact. R-22, for example, is a popular choice due to its compatibility with older AC systems. However, it's a potent greenhouse gas and contributing factor to climate change. In contrast, R-410A is a more environmentally friendly option, but it's more expensive and requires specialized equipment.
